Appetizers

  • Wonton Soup:A classic Chinese appetizer, wonton soup features savory pork-filled wontons swimming in a flavorful broth. The wontons are typically made with a delicate wrapper and a juicy, seasoned filling.
  • Egg Rolls:Crispy and golden brown, egg rolls are a popular appetizer filled with a mixture of vegetables, meat, and sometimes seafood. They are often served with a dipping sauce.
  • Spring Rolls:Similar to egg rolls, spring rolls are made with a thin rice paper wrapper and filled with a variety of vegetables. They are typically served fresh, without frying.

Main Courses

  • Kung Pao Chicken:A classic Sichuan dish, Kung Pao Chicken is a spicy and flavorful stir-fry made with chicken, peanuts, and vegetables. The dish is known for its bold flavors and vibrant red color.
  • General Tso’s Chicken:Another popular dish, General Tso’s Chicken is a sweet and tangy dish made with fried chicken tossed in a flavorful sauce. The chicken is typically coated in a crispy batter and glazed with a sticky sauce.
  • Mapo Tofu:A spicy and savory dish from Sichuan, Mapo Tofu is made with soft tofu, ground pork, and a spicy sauce. The dish is known for its complex flavors and numbing heat.

Noodles, Best chinese food in nashville

  • Dan Dan Noodles:A popular street food from Sichuan, Dan Dan Noodles are made with wheat noodles tossed in a spicy sauce made with sesame paste, chili oil, and minced pork.
  • Wonton Noodles:A comforting dish, wonton noodles feature egg noodles served in a flavorful broth with wontons and vegetables.
  • Lo Mein:A classic noodle dish, lo mein is made with wheat noodles stir-fried with vegetables and meat or seafood. The noodles are typically soft and chewy.

Rice Dishes

  • Fried Rice:A versatile dish, fried rice is made with rice stir-fried with vegetables, meat, and sometimes eggs. It can be customized to include a variety of ingredients.
  • Congee:A comforting and savory dish, congee is made with rice porridge cooked with meat, vegetables, or seafood. It is often served as a breakfast or late-night meal.

Techniques

  • Stir-frying: Stir-frying is a popular technique that involves cooking ingredients rapidly in a hot wok or skillet. This method retains the crispness of vegetables and imparts a smoky flavor to dishes like Kung Pao chicken and Mongolian beef.
  • Steaming: Steaming is a gentle cooking method that preserves the natural flavors and nutrients of ingredients. It is often used for delicate dishes such as steamed fish, dim sum, and vegetable dumplings.
  • Braising: Braising involves slowly simmering meats or vegetables in a flavorful liquid. This technique tenderizes the ingredients and infuses them with rich, complex flavors, as seen in dishes like braised pork belly and lion’s head meatballs.
  • Roasting: Roasting is a technique used to cook meats and poultry in an oven. It creates a crispy exterior and tender, juicy interior, as exemplified by dishes like Peking duck and roasted char siu pork.
